Is cesarean section dangerous? Mothers must know

In recent years, with the improvement of people's living standards, many pregnant women have become overweight, which makes natural childbirth very difficult. Therefore, many women choose to give birth by caesarean section. But is a caesarean section dangerous? Most expectant mothers don't know much about this. In fact, cesarean section is risky for both the mother and the baby, so mothers must be cautious when choosing this method of delivery.

1. The main risks of caesarean section

1. Maternal

The possibility of postoperative complications is 10 to 40 times greater than that of natural delivery;

The amount of bleeding is several times that of natural childbirth;

There are risks of anesthesia and organ damage during surgery;

Surgery causes extensive trauma and results in longer pain and recovery time.

2. For babies

Susceptibility to cesarean section syndrome, i.e. acute respiratory distress;

The incidence of jaundice is higher than that of natural delivery;

They are prone to sensory integration disorder, which is a poor coordination of the brain that affects children's attention, verbal expression and interpersonal communication, hindering their healthy growth.

3. Reminder: Don’t blindly choose cesarean section

A cesarean section is not the best option for childbirth, either for the baby or the mother. Unless you have to, do not choose a cesarean section blindly, especially not just because you are afraid of pain, to prevent vaginal relaxation, or even simply to choose an "auspicious day".

Second, the advantages of cesarean section:

(1) When vaginal delivery is absolutely impossible for some reason, a caesarean section can save the lives of mother and child.

(2) The indications for cesarean section are clear, and anesthesia and surgery are generally smooth.

(3) If an elective cesarean section is performed before uterine contractions begin, the mother can be spared the pain of labor.

(4) If there are other diseases in the abdominal cavity, they can also be treated together. For example, combined with ovarian tumors or subserosal uterine fibroids, they can be removed at the same time.

(5) It is also very convenient to perform ligation surgery.

(6) In cases where it is not appropriate to retain the uterus, such as severe infection, incomplete uterine rupture, multiple uterine fibroids, etc., the uterus can also be removed at the same time.

(7) Due to the improvement in the safety of cesarean section in recent years, many pregnancy complications and pregnancy termination have been treated by clinicians, which has reduced the impact of complications on mother and child.
